본문 바로가기
JAVA

Sort

by Minius 2018. 2. 20.
반응형

1. 배열 : Arrays.sort()

2. Collections.sort()

-List

-Set : List로 변환 뒤 sort

-Map : Set -> List 로 변환 뒤 sort(entrySet() 사용)


3. Comparable 인터페이스 : 정렬하고자 하는 객체 내에서 Comparable 구현

compareTo() 재정의. 한 가지의 정렬방법만 기본 제공


4. Comparator 인터페이스 : 기본 정렬 방법 이외 sort 알고리즘을 적용하고자 할 때 사용.

구현된 객체를 Arrays.sort(), Collections.sort()에 정렬 대상 객체와 함께 인자로 넘겨준다.

'JAVA' 카테고리의 다른 글

Thread  (0) 2018.03.08
객체지향 프로그래밍  (0) 2018.03.05
이름 나이 오름차순 내림차순  (0) 2018.02.20
배열 정렬  (0) 2018.02.20
JAVA 자바 빵 예제 (ver.강사님)  (0) 2018.02.10

댓글